Compare all specifications:
2009 Saturn Vue | 2010 Chevrolet Malibu | |
Make | Saturn | Chevrolet |
Model | Vue | Malibu |
Year Released | 2009 | 2010 |
Body Type | SUV |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3562 cc | 2400 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 249 HP | 170 HP |
Engine RPM | 6300 RPM | 6200 RPM |
Torque | 251 Nm | 214 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3200 RPM | 5200 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Flex Fuel |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4860 mm | 4872 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1860 mm | 1786 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1710 mm | 1450 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2710 mm | 2852 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 61 L | 61 L |
